All about Markers
Markers move along the X-axis range of the measurement trace to provide a numerical readout of
each measured data point. Markers also allow you to search for specific Y-axis values.
A trace can contain up to six markers.
The marker readout on the FieldFox screen displays X and Y-axis information for the current active
marker ONLY.
A Marker Table can be displayed that allows you to simultaneously view X and Y-axis information
for all markers.
Markers can be used in CAT, I/Q Analyzer, NA, NF, RTSA, SA, and Pulse Measurements Modes.
How to create Markers
—Press Marker.
Then Markers 1...6
to select a marker to activate.
Then Normal
to activate that marker. A marker is created on the trace in the middle of the
X-axis. That marker is now active.
Then move the marker using the rotary knob, the arrows, or by entering an X-axis position
with the number keys.
Then press Enter
.
How to move a Marker after it is created
—Press Marker.
Then Markers 1...6
repeatedly until the marker of interest is selected. The OFF, Normal, or Delta
softkey is black to indicate the current setting of each marker.
Then move the marker as when it was first created.
Markers can also be moved using one of the marker search functions. Refer to “Searching with
Markers” on page 196.
